So the past 12 months, I have been working on a very large program that launches today on a single handset, 8 by April, and all of Alltel's lineup by the end of the year. 6 companies, 92 people, and lots of hard work has gone into making this a reality. The mobile software space is extremely difficult to manage and build for.
frog and Alltel are very excited about the future of this application in the mobile space. We are continuing to expand the platform, allow developers around the world to build cells (mini applications) for it, and build it into a Windows Mobile application and new features across all platforms for all of Alltel's handset lineup (currently 25 phones).

As RIM develops more consumer targetted products and services along with IPhone I think we are on the edge of a new wave of wireless applications.
Not applications that give you stock quotes or weather but much more. The key to expanding wireless (IMHO) is GPS integration. That way I can know what is going on around me. i.e. "shooting 4 blocks from you at xyz/yyz intersection" ... "<famous> was spotted 3 blocks from you at .... interection" ... "your friend Bob is at Dunbar Bar" ... "The <event> is going on downtown at <location>".
Dodgeball is the closest idea to a concept we came up with except of course we have another zillion ideas of how to not only market this but make it more of a demand consumer solution.

Today was a very exciting day for Alltel Wireless and frog design. Celltop was announced to the world.
The culmination of the two teams with partners Motricity and Qualcomm, as well as integral OEM's such as Samsung, Motorola, and LG, have launched a BREW application built on numerous Qualcomm platforms to give Alltel customers a simple quick reach approach on their handsets to the things they need and do on a daily basis.
frog has built this platform from conception to delivery, including the name and logo. This program has demonstrated our process to near perfection with our Aricent partners.
